BOWIE, MD- The women's tennis team rounded out their season during the semifinal round of the 2019 CIAA Championship on May 3.
After lining up against the Golden Bulls of Johnson C. Smith University for day 2 of the CIAA Championship, the Trojans fell short of a victory with a 4-1 loss.
Scoring for the Trojans in the No. 2 singles was junior Kaela Mack with game victories of 6-3 and 6-1.
Under the leadership of head coach Donald Raspberry, the Trojans ended the regular season with a 9-6 overall record, 9-5 in the conference and 6-0 in the Northern Division.
VSU, who entered championship play as the overall No. 3 seed, ended the post season with a 1-1 championship record, 10-7 on the season.
